Abstract

The invention discloses a liquefied petroleum gas bottle valve handling machine with functions of torque controlling and angle phase positioning. The liquefied petroleum gas bottle valve handling machine is provided with a motor, a rack, a bottle clamping air cylinder, an electric control system and a gas bottle; a vertically-arranged output shaft is arranged at the lower end of the motor; the lower end of the output shaft is connected with a speed reducer through a flange; the speed reducer is connected with a sliding shaft; the sliding shaft is arranged at the top of the rack in a penetrating way; the sliding shaft is connected with a connection shaft through a coupler; a valve clip is sleeved at the lower end of the connection shaft; and the electric control system is connected in parallel with a first alternative-current sensor, a torque sensor and a second alternative-current sensor.. With the adoption of the liquefied petroleum gas bottle valve handling machine provided by the invention, final mounting torque of a liquefied petroleum gas bottle valve can be effectively controlled, and the final mounting angle phase position of the bottle valve is accurate.

Technical field
The present invention relates to a kind of gas apparatus field, especially a kind of system liquefied petroleum gas cylinder valve charging crane of locating mutually with moment of torsion control, angle.
Background technology
Original cylinder valve charging crane after machine dress valve is accomplished, needs artificial adjustment angular phasing to put owing to the termination angular phasing is installed is put uncertainly, could finally accomplish liquefied petroleum gas cylinder valve and install.Operating efficiency is low, and is big to the cylinder valve damage.
Summary of the invention
To original cylinder valve charging crane existing problems, the present invention provides a kind of liquefied petroleum gas cylinder valve charging crane of locating mutually with moment of torsion control, angle, can effectively control liquefied petroleum gas cylinder valve the termination moment of torsion is installed, and make cylinder valve that the termination angular phasing is installed to put correctly.
Technical scheme of the present invention comprises motor, frame, folder bottle cylinder, gas cylinder; The motor lower end is provided with the output shaft of vertical setting, and the output shaft lower end is connected with reductor through flange, and reductor is connected with sliding axle; The top that sliding axle passes frame is provided with; Sliding axle is connected with through shaft coupling and connects axle, connects a lower end socket valve card, electric-control system be connected in parallel first ac sensor, torque sensor, second ac sensor.
The output of first ac sensor is connected with first ac sensor button; First ac sensor button output is connected with dress valve button, torque sensor button and second ac sensor button, angle level sensor button respectively; Torque sensor button and second ac sensor button are connected in series; Dress valve button, torque sensor button and second ac sensor button, angle level sensor button are connected in parallel; The torque sensor output also connects dressing valve button, torque sensor button and second ac sensor, angle level sensor button respectively; The output of second ac sensor is connecting the 3rd ac sensor button; The 3rd ac sensor button output connecting respectively and unloading valve button, the 4th ac sensor button; Unload the valve button and the 4th ac sensor button is connected in parallel, dress valve button, second ac sensor button, angle level sensor button, the output that unloads valve button, the 4th ac sensor button all are connected with stop button, the stop button ammeter that is connected in series.
Valve is stuck in the bottleneck of twisted gas cylinder under the motor operation, and twisted angle is in 360 °
Correct control cylinder valve was installed the termination angular phasing and is put when the control liquefied petroleum gas cylinder valve was installed the termination moment of torsion.
The motion that motor realizes loading and unloading cylinder valve through transmission system, during bottling valve, moment of torsion reaches setting value, and torque sensor breaks off the NK contact earlier, and motor continues to tighten cylinder valve, in less than 360 ° of angles, arrives and specifies angular phasing to put, angular displacement sensor disconnection XK contact.Accomplish dress valve operation.
The present invention makes cylinder valve that the termination angular phasing is installed and puts correctly when having realized that liquefied petroleum gas cylinder valve is installed the control of termination moment of torsion.Greatly improved dress valve work efficiency, alleviated cylinder valve is damaged.
